Capital Markets
Markets that deal in the buying and selling of long-term debt or equity-backed securities to help in capital acquisition.
Insider Information
Confidential information pertaining to a company's activities, unshared with the general public, that could influence an investor's decision to buy or sell the company's stock.
Financial Manager
A professional responsible for managing the financial activities of a company, including planning, organizing, controlling, and monitoring financial resources to achieve organizational goals.
Capital Market History
The historical evolution and record of financial markets that deal with the buying and selling of long-term debt or equity-backed securities.
